If a line perpendicular to 2y=x+5 that passes through (2,1) using the slope- intercept form
arlik [135]
Slope of  2y = x + 5:-
This is y = 0.5 x + 2.5  in slope intercept form so its slope = 0.5

Slope of the line perpendicular to it = -1 / 0.5 = -2

it passes through (2 , 1) so we have

y- 1 = -2(x - 2)
y = -2x + 4 + 1

The answer is y = -2x + 5
